Washington DC: Samuel H. Smith (printer), 1804 An American classic. Quite scarce. Condition notes: 204 numbered pp; HB. Pages: mostly clean with a bit of marginalia, tanned, a bit loose; small book store label to front pastedown, ink notes to front eps, title page, and rear blanks, front hinge cracked, pages sunned with some small stains Cover: full leather, well worn, spine re-backed in leather w/ some ffep insect damage to the repair (no body lives here anymore, though), no titles; substantial edge/shelfwear, extrems well worn. A great, scarce book with definite condition issues.

Our book rating standards are as follows; nearly all of our stock is VG or better: As New (AN)-just as states, clean, bright, tight, no defects. Fine-AN, but not as bright, minor marks or other minor defects. Very Good (VG)-small to modest tears, chips, marks, cocked etc. Good (G)-not so much, with larger tears or chips, possibly soiled, cocked, etc. Fair-ugly, with pages or large areas of DJ missing or other major defects. Poor(P)-truly ugly, disbound or requiring other major rehabilitation. We stabilize most minor defects with archival quality materials, and with few exceptions, these stabilizations are reversible
